Biography: "Full-time starter the past two years after seeing action with the first team as a freshman. All-Conference selection after
his junior and senior seasons. Led East Carolina in receiving last year with 101/1123/10, and also averaged 11.7 yards on
19 punt returns and 20.5 yards on 41 kick returns. Junior totals included 83/978/7 at receiver with a 27 yard average on 47
kick returns, three which were brought back for scores."
Positives: "Smallish, underneath receiver who offers versatility as a return specialist. Displays quickness into routes, nicely makes catches in stride, and adjusts to errant throws. Comes back to the ball to make himself an available target and uses his hands to catch the ball away from his body. Makes the difficult catch with defenders draped on him. Displays good quickness." Negatives: "One-speed receiver who cannot run to daylight in the open field. Gets lazy running routes on occasion. Looked poor during the Senior Bowl, dropping a large number of passes." Analysis: Harris has been ultra-productive the past two seasons and projects as a fourth receiver in the NFL but must produce on special teams. Projection: 6th
